Density Altitude at Malta (M75)
Malta sits at 2,254 ft, and even a typical July afternoon (86 °F) only lifts density altitude to about 4,505 ft — heat still trims performance, but the field rarely turns high-and-hot.
Typical density altitude by month
| Month | Avg temp °F | DA at avg temp | Afternoon high °F | DA on a typical afternoon |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| January | 17.6 | −18 ft | 28.6 | 759 ft |
| February | 21.5 | 260 ft | 32.4 | 1,022 ft |
| March | 33.0 | 1,063 ft | 45.0 | 1,877 ft |
| April | 45.9 | 1,937 ft | 59.0 | 2,797 ft |
| May | 55.6 | 2,576 ft | 68.8 | 3,423 ft |
| June | 64.3 | 3,137 ft | 76.9 | 3,929 ft |
| July | 71.9 | 3,618 ft | 86.3 | 4,505 ft |
| August | 70.7 | 3,542 ft | 85.6 | 4,463 ft |
| September | 60.0 | 2,861 ft | 74.4 | 3,774 ft |
| October | 46.3 | 1,964 ft | 59.4 | 2,823 ft |
| November | 31.8 | 981 ft | 43.3 | 1,763 ft |
| December | 20.8 | 211 ft | 31.3 | 946 ft |
▲ above 5,000 ft · ⚠ above 8,000 ft. These are planning references at standard pressure and dry air — afternoon humidity and low pressure both push the real number higher. Run today's values below.

Frequently asked questions
How high does density altitude get at M75 in summer?
On a typical July afternoon — around 86 °F at the nearest NOAA normals station — density altitude at Malta reaches roughly 4,505 ft at standard pressure. Hotter-than-normal days, low pressure, and humidity all push it higher, so run the day's actual numbers before flying.
What is the density altitude at M75 on an average day?
It swings with the seasons: from roughly −18 ft at the coldest month's average temperature to about 3,618 ft at the warmest month's — all from a constant field elevation of 2,254 ft. The month-by-month table above carries the full year.
What is the field elevation of Malta?
2,254 ft MSL, from the FAA NASR airport record (28-day cycle effective 2026-08-06). The identifier is M75 (FAA), in Malta, Montana.
